How long is a year on Kepler-16b?
229 daysKepler-16b / Orbital period
Kepler-16b orbits around both stars every 229 days, similar to Venus’ 225-day orbit, but lies outside the system’s habitable zone, where liquid water could exist on the surface, because the stars are cooler than our sun.

Is Kepler-16b hot or cold?
NASA mission may be first to find alien moon, expert says. A new planet found last fall may be orbiting two stars, but it’s far from a real-life Tatooine. Dubbed Kepler-16b, the world is a cold, Saturn-size gas giant with little chance of hosting desert farmers like the fictional Star Wars world.

What is Kepler-16b made out of?
Kepler-16b (formally Kepler-16 (AB)-b) is an extrasolar planet. It is a Saturn-mass planet consisting of half gas and half rock and ice, and it orbits a binary star, Kepler-16, with a period of 229 days.
Why is Kepler-16b habitable?
This planet, however, is likely cold, about the size of Saturn and gaseous, though partly composed of rock. It lies outside its two stars’ “habitable zone,” where liquid water could exist. And its stars are cooler than our sun, probably rendering the planet lifeless.
